Let table AM insertion methods control index insertion
Previously, the executor did index insert unconditionally after calling table AM interface methods tuple_insert() and multi_insert(). This commit introduces the new parameter insert_indexes for these two methods. Setting '*insert_indexes' to true saves the current logic. Setting it to false indicates that table AM cares about index inserts itself and doesn't want the caller to do that.
